Weed Is Now Officially Legal In New Jersey

Weed smokers in New Jersey have something to celebrate. On Monday, Governor Phil Murphy signed three separate bills that allow a person to carry up to six ounces of marijuana for recreational use.

“As of this moment, New Jersey’s broken and indefensible marijuana laws, which permanently stained the records of many residents and short-circuited their futures, and which disproportionately hurt communities of color and failed the meaning of justice at every level, social or otherwise — are no more,” said Gov. Murphy before putting pen to paper."

"Starting immediately, those who had been subject to an arrest for petty marijuana possession — an arrest that may have kept them from a job or the opportunity to further their education — will be able to get relief and move forward,” he added.
